| // On Linux, these are a signed 32-bit integer. However, on Mac, they are an |
| // unsigned 32-bit integer. Thus, for cross-platform compatibility, and to |
| // provide a special "invalid/not set" value, define the type as a 64-bit signed |
| // integer. |
| using NetworkInterfaceIndex = int64_t; |
| enum : NetworkInterfaceIndex { kInvalidNetworkInterfaceIndex = -1 }; |

| struct IPSubnet { |
| // TODO(btolsch): Only needed until c++14. |
| IPSubnet(); |
| IPSubnet(const IPAddress& address, uint8_t prefix_length); |
| ~IPSubnet(); |
| |
| IPAddress address; |
| |
| // Prefix length of |address|, which is another way of specifying a subnet |
| // mask. For example, 192.168.0.10/24 is a common representation of the |
| // address 192.168.0.10 with a 24-bit prefix, and therefore a subnet mask of |
| // 255.255.255.0. |
| uint8_t prefix_length = 0; |
| }; |
